An Overview of Papua New Guinea's Financial Sector
Papua New Guinea (PNG) is a developing country located in the Oceania region of the Pacific. The country's economy heavily relies on agriculture, mining, and forestry, but in recent years the financial sector has been growing steadily. PNG's financial services industry offers a range of services, including banking, insurance, and capital markets.
Banking in PNG
Banking is the most prominent segment of the financial sector in PNG, with the country's central bank, the Bank of Papua New Guinea, responsible for supervising and regulating commercial banks and other financial institutions. The country's banking sector is dominated by four major banks: Bank South Pacific (BSP), Westpac, ANZ, and the National Development Bank (NDB). BSP is the largest bank, accounting for around 50% of the banking industry's total assets.
BSP offers a range of services to its customers, including personal banking, business banking, and institutional banking. The bank has a strong focus on financial inclusion and has been expanding its branch network into rural areas to provide banking services to customers who are not able to access physical banking facilities easily.
Insurance in PNG
The insurance industry in PNG is still in its early stages of development, with the market dominated by a few major companies. However, the industry has been growing rapidly, with both life and non-life insurance products becoming more popular.
Capital markets in PNG
The country has a small capital market with a limited number of investment opportunities. The Port Moresby Stock Exchange is the only stock exchange in PNG, and its market capitalization is relatively small compared to other regional stock markets. However, the exchange has been growing steadily over the years and has become an important source of capital for local businesses.
Challenges faced by the financial sector in PNG
PNG's financial sector faces several challenges due to the country's geography and infrastructure. The majority of the population lives in rural areas, making the provision of financial services to these areas difficult. The lack of physical infrastructure, such as roads, airports, and shipping ports, also adds to the difficulty of providing financial services to remote areas.
Furthermore, the country's financial sector has been affected by the global economic downturn and the COVID-19 pandemic. Reduced demand for commodities, particularly from China, has hit PNG's mining and resource sectors hard, affecting the country's economic growth.
